TRIBE ISCHYROCERINI STEBBING, 1899

Diagnosis

Pereopod 5 carpus long, subrectangular. Pereopods 5–7 dactyli lacking accessory spines on anterior margin. Uropods 1 and 2 peduncle with acute interamal process, without distoventral corona of cuticular spines. Uropod 3 peduncle long, broad proximally, narrow distally. Telson entire, without rows of hooks or patches of denticles (Myers & Lowry, 2003).

Included genera

Bathyphotis Stephensen, 1944; Coxischyrocerus Just, 2009; Isaeopsis K.H. Barnard, 1916; Ischyrocerus Krøyer, 1838; Jassa Leach, 1814; Microjassa Stebbing, 1899; Myersius gen. nov.; Neoischyrocerus Conlan, 1995; Paradryope Stebbing, 1888; Parajassa Stebbing, 1899; Pseudischyrocerus Schellenberg, 1931; Ruffojassa Vader & Myers, 1996; Scutischyrocerus Myers, 1995; Tropischyrocerus Just, 2009; Ventojassa J.L. Barnard, 1970; Veronajassa Vader & Myers, 1996.
